Favorable Score For IELTS!
Top Canadian universities ask for band score of 7.0. However, a minimum overall score of 6.0 bands is mandatory to get a Canadian student visa. Worry not if you have scored 5.5 bands in any of the individual modules, the overall score is only considered by the Canadian government.

1). Regretful Temporary Cap On Study Permits!
This update of Canada is a shocker to all the aspirants. Wondering what is it?
The Canadian government announced a reduction of international students by 35% on January 22, 2024. This year only 360,000 permits are expected to be granted. Canada also announced a study permit cap of 50% for undergraduates in Ontario, home of the Ottawa, national gallery. These provinces which need sustainable growth can allocate caps on individual institutions.
Are you a postgraduate in Canada?
You have a reason to celebrate, you were excluded from this study permit cap. If you are already pursuing your education in Canada and planning to renew it, you are also saved.

WHY ARE TEMPORARY CAPS INTRODUCED?
This is due to the overflow of international students in Canada. This causes housing and healthcare challenges in significant provinces. Canada is also considerable in saving international students from paying huge fees to institutions.

Consequences Of The Initiative:
- Competition- It has increased the competition among undergraduate students. Especially in provinces like Ontario, British Columbia and Nova Scotia, competition of international students has increased due to a greater reduction in Study Permit.
- Extra documents- extra time- With this initiative, you must submit an additional document of attestation letter from a specific province. This can result in increased processing time and delays for aspirants applying this summer.

2. Check On PGWP!
From September 2024, the Post Graduate Work Permit (PGWP) is no longer applicable for international students graduating from public-private partnership (PPP) institutions. This is to save international students from PPP institutions providing less curriculum regulatory insights. 3. Rise In PGWP For Post-Graduates!
Postgraduates, you can celebrate your extended work permit duration of 3 years from February 15 of this year. But remember, you should meet all the eligibility criteria for PGWP.

4. Change In Spousal Work Permit!
Unlike last year, Canada has restricted open work permits to spouses of those enrolled in Master's and doctoral professional programs like law and medicine.

5. Increase In Cost Of Living!
Unfortunately, Canada has increased the required funds to CAD 20, 635 from CAD 10,000 in January 2024. You must provide proof of funds for your hassle-free living in Canada.
